Whereas the antiinflammatory effects of high density lipoprotein(HDL) are well described,such effects of Apolipoprotein A-I(ApoA-I) are less studied.On the basis of our previous study,we furtherly explored the mechanism of antiinflammatory effects of ApoA-I,and focused especially on the interaction between monocyte and endothelial cells and plasma HDL inflammatory index in LPS-challenged rabbits.The results showed that ApoA-I significantly decreased LPS-induced MCP-1 release of THP-1 cells and oxLDL-induced THP-1 migration ratio(P<0.01 respectively). ApoA-I significantly decreased sL-selectin,slCAM-1 and sVCAM-1 release of LPS-stimulated THP-1 cells(P<0.01,P<0.01,P<0.05 respectively).Furthermore, ApoA-I significantly inhibited LPS-induced CD11b and VCAM-1 expressions on THP-1 cells(P<0.01,P<0.05 respectively).ApoA-I diminished LPS-induced mCD14 expression(P<0.01) and NFκB nuclear translocation in THP-1 cells.After single dosage treatment of ApoA-I,the value of plasma HDL inflammatory index in LPS-challenged rabbits was improved significantly(P<0.05).Conclusions:ApoA-I can inhibit the chemotaxis,adhesion and activation of THP-1 cells and impove plasma HDL inflammatory index with presenting beneficial antiinflammatory effects.
